Output 93c126aea3beed14091c0ce82c528afa3a3e345cc9f1d610d832a3620d57c768:28

value
21836818
script pubkey
OP_0 OP_PUSHBYTES_20 3db6872fd7e915abb5f00c3a88892e952c800168
address
ltc1q8kmgwt7hay26hd0spsag3zfwj5kgqqtgk6y28j
transaction
93c126aea3beed14091c0ce82c528afa3a3e345cc9f1d610d832a3620d57c768
spent
true